• php运算符的优先级是什么

    PHP运算符的优先级是指在一个表达式中,哪个运算符会先进行计算。以下是PHP运算符的优先级,从高到低: ():括号 ++、--:前缀自增、前缀自减 !、~、+、-、@:逻辑非、按位取反、正号、负号、抑制错误 **:指数 *、/、%:乘法、除法、取模 +、-:加法、减法 .:字符串连接 <<、>>:左移、右移 <、<=、>、>=:小于、小于等于、大于、大于等于 ==、!=、...

  • mybatis selectlist的用法是什么

    在MyBatis中,selectList方法用于执行查询操作并返回多条记录。其用法如下: List<MyObject> myObjects = sqlSession.selectList("namespace.statementId", parameter); 其中,namespace是指Mapper XML文件中命名空间的名称,statementId是指具体查询语句的id,parameter是指传入查询...

  • 在Bokeh中如何创建和使用滑动条来改变图表数据

    要在Bokeh中创建和使用滑动条来改变图表数据,可以使用Bokeh库中的Slider组件。下面是一个简单的示例代码,演示了如何创建一个带有滑动条的图表,并根据滑动条的值来更新图表数据: from bokeh.plotting import figure, curdoc from bokeh.models import Slider, ColumnDataSource from bokeh.layouts import...

  • php内存管理机制是什么

    PHP的内存管理机制主要基于垃圾回收(Garbage Collection)和引用计数(Reference Counting)两种方式。 引用计数:PHP使用引用计数来跟踪变量的引用情况,当一个变量被引用时,引用计数会增加;当一个变量不再被引用时,引用计数会减少。当引用计数为0时,即没有任何变量指向该内存区域时,内存会被释放。 垃圾回收:PHP还实现了垃圾回收机制来处理循环引用等情况。垃圾回收器会定期扫描内存中的...

  • 如何使用Selenium进行测试用例的优先级排序

    在Selenium中,可以使用TestNG测试框架来对测试用例进行优先级排序。以下是一些步骤来实现测试用例的优先级排序: 在测试类中使用@Test注解来标记测试方法,并使用priority属性来设置测试方法的优先级。例如: @Test(priority = 1) public void testMethod1() { // 测试逻辑 } @Test(priority = 2) public void test...

  • r语言数据排序的规则是什么

    在R语言中,数据排序的规则取决于使用的排序函数。常见的排序函数包括sort()、order()、rank()、arrange()等。 sort()函数可以对向量或数组进行排序,对于向量可以按升序或降序排序,可以使用decreasing = TRUE参数来指定降序排序。 order()函数返回排序后的索引位置,可以根据这个索引对数据进行排序。 rank()函数用于计算数据的排名,返回数据在排序后的序号。 arrange(...

  • 怎么使用spaCy压缩和解压缩文本

    在 spaCy 中,要对文本进行压缩和解压缩,可以使用 spaCy 的 nlp 对象对文本进行处理。以下是一个示例代码来演示如何使用 spaCy 对文本进行压缩和解压缩: import spacy # 加载 spaCy 的英文模型 nlp = spacy.load('en_core_web_sm') # 定义要处理的文本 text = "This is a sample text that we will comp...

  • mybatis动态标签怎么使用

    MyBatis提供了一些动态标签来构建动态SQL语句,常用的动态标签有if、choose、when、otherwise、foreach等。下面是一个示例,演示如何使用MyBatis的动态标签: 假设有一个User类,包含id、username和age属性: public class User { private Long id; private String username; private...

  • Seaborn的bins参数有什么作用

    在Seaborn中,bins参数用于指定要将数据分成多少个等宽箱子(bin)进行显示。通过调整bins参数,可以控制直方图中箱子的数量,从而影响直方图的精度和显示效果。更多的箱子可以提供更详细的数据分布信息,但可能会导致直方图过于拥挤。更少的箱子则会提供更粗略的数据分布信息,但可能会丢失一些细节。bins参数可以帮助用户在平衡数据展示的详细程度和清晰度之间进行选择。...

  • Pillow库怎么生成图像的光晕效果

    Pillow库是Python的一个图像处理库,它提供了丰富的图像处理功能。要生成图像的光晕效果,可以使用Pillow库中的ImageFilter模块来实现。 下面是一个使用Pillow库生成图像的光晕效果的示例代码: from PIL import Image, ImageFilter # 打开图像文件 image = Image.open('image.jpg') # 添加光晕效果 blurred_image =...

  • c#拼接字符串的方法是什么

    在C#中,拼接字符串的方法有多种,其中最常用的方法是使用加号(+)或String.Concat方法。例如: 使用加号(+): string str1 = "Hello"; string str2 = "World"; string result = str1 + " " + str2; Console.WriteLine(result); // 输出:Hello World 使用String.Concat方法: st...

  • c语言中如何查找指定字符

    在C语言中,可以使用strchr()函数或者自定义函数来查找指定字符。 使用strchr()函数: #include <stdio.h> #include <string.h> int main() { char str[] = "Hello, World!"; char ch = 'o'; char *result; result = strchr(str,...

  • php cache的功能有哪些

    提高网站性能:通过缓存可以减少服务器请求次数,加快网站的加载速度,提高用户体验。 减少服务器负载:缓存可以减少服务器的负载,避免频繁的数据库查询和计算,提高服务器的稳定性和性能。 减少网络流量:通过缓存可以减少网络传输的数据量,节省带宽资源,提高网站的访问速度。 提高数据安全性:通过缓存可以减少对数据库的直接访问,降低数据库被攻击的风险。 支持离线访问:缓存可以在用户离线的情况下提供数据访问,提高网站...

  • 怎么使用Seaborn处理缺失值

    在Seaborn中处理缺失值主要是通过使用Pandas库来完成。下面是一些处理缺失值的方法: 删除缺失值:可以使用Pandas中的dropna()方法来删除包含缺失值的行或列。 import seaborn as sns import pandas as pd # 创建一个包含缺失值的DataFrame data = {'A': [1, 2, None, 4], 'B': [5, None, 7, 8...

  • Scrapy如何设置下载延迟

    Scrapy框架可以通过设置DOWNLOAD_DELAY参数来控制下载延迟,即每次请求之间的时间间隔。您可以在settings.py文件中进行设置,示例如下: DOWNLOAD_DELAY = 2 # 设置下载延迟为2秒 您还可以通过在Spider类中设置download_delay属性来实现相同的效果,示例如下: class MySpider(scrapy.Spider): name = 'my_spid...